Overview

Performs duties which include administering road examinations to all applicants for all classes of drivers licenses, performs clerical functions which include greeting customers and assisting with questions, reviewing applications and documentation for applicants for drivers licenses and vehicle title, registration and licensing transactions, administers various tests including written and vision tests, uses computer system to enter data and record testing results; performs cashiering functions related to the drives license transactions and balances funds to transactions performed on that day.

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Administers road examinations to applicants for all classes of driver’s licenses; explains improper actions to applicants during the examination; codes applications according to examination results.
  • Serves as information clerk directing applicants and public to proper areas of the facility to receive service.
  • Reviews and completes driver’s license applications or motor vehicle registration or title applications for processing while gathering all pertinent information to serve the applicant.
  • Administers vision tests to driver’s license applicants, codes applications according to results.
  • Administers and grades written driver examinations; explains incorrect test responses; codes applications according to results.
  • Enters applications or other drivers license or related forms on computer terminal, reviews entry for completeness and accuracy.
  • Operates photographic equipment; prepares photo ID/drivers licenses for receipt of applicant.
  • Balances cash or checks with validation tape totals to assure that all fees are accurately accounted for; prepares deposit records or other routine financial documents necessary to process collected fees; may prepare reports on applications processed.
  • Performs cashiering functions for driver’s license fees.
  • In a limited-service facility, reviews, fee checks and checks for necessary attachments on the majority of types of motor vehicle registration or title forms; accepts cash or checks for fees and prepares for final processing; issues temporary registration permits.
  • In a full-service motor vehicle facility, reviews, fee checks and checks for necessary attachments, various types of motor vehicle registration or title forms including leased vehicles and dealer and remitter work.
  • Performs other duties as required or assigned.
Specific Skills:
  • Requires working knowledge of business English, spelling and commercial arithmetic.
  • Requires working knowledge of office methods, practices and procedures.
  • Requires elementary knowledge of the Illinois Vehicle Code as it applies to office tasks pertaining to obtaining or retaining a valid Illinois driver’s license and the processing of various motor vehicle forms.
  • Requires elementary knowledge of basic bookkeeping procedures and techniques.
  • Requires ability to maintain records of some complexity.
  • Requires ability to deal tactfully with the general public and to maintain satisfactory working relationships with other employees.
  • Requires ability to communicate both orally and in writing.
  • Requires ability to translate and interpret for Spanish speaking customers.
  • Requires ability to operate in an independent manner within defined procedures.
  • Requires possession of a valid Illinois driver’s license.
Education and Work Experience:
  • Requires knowledge, skill and mental development equivalent to the completion of elementary school AND two (2) years of general office experience, preferably including one year in a driver or motor vehicle facility and operation of keyboard equipment.
  • Position requires a valid Illinois Driver’s license.
